Cisco Packet Tracer 8.2.2
Temat: budowa i modelowanie „inteligentnej” szklarni w Cisco Packet Tracer 8.2.2.
Cel: automatyczne utrzymanie komfortowych warunków do uprawy (na przykładzie pomidorów-cherry) — temperatura, wilgotność, poziom wody, oświetlenie — oraz wysyłanie powiadomień o wszelkich zmianach.
Założenia wyjściowe
| Parametr | Zakres normalny | Próg krytyczny |
|---|---|---|
| Temperatura gleby/powietrza | 20 – 30 °C | < 20 °C lub > 30 °C |
| Wilgotność powietrza | 40 – 70 % | < 40 % lub > 70 % |
| Poziom wody w zbiorniku | 20 – 80 % | < 20 % lub > 80 % |
| Oświetlenie | włączone 18:00-06:00 | wyłączone w ciągu dnia |
Urządzenia fizyczne (IoT)
| Nazwa (Display Name) | Typ | Funkcja |
|---|---|---|
| IoT4 Door | Drzwi | Zautomatyzowane otwieranie/zamykanie (start — zamknięte) |
| IoT13 RFID Reader | Czytnik | Dostęp za pomocą karty (ID = 1001) |
| IoT1 Light | Lampa | Dodatkowe oświetlenie nocą |
| IoT3 Fan | Wentylator | Chłodzenie, cyrkulacja powietrza |
| IoT10 Furnace | Nagrzewnica | Ogrzewanie przy < 20 °C |
| IoT2 Lawn Sprinkler | Zraszacz | Podlewanie przy niskiej wilgotności |
| IoT5 Water Drain | Odpływ | Odprowadzanie nadmiaru wody |
| IoT6 Water Level Monitor | Czujnik poziomu wody | 0 – 100 % |
| IoT11 Humidity Monitor | Czujnik wilgotności | 0 – 100 % |
| IoT8 Thermostat | Termostat | Temperatura °C |
| IoT9 Smoke Detector | Czujnik dymu | Alarm przy dymie |
| IoT0 Window | Okno | Automatyczne wietrzenie |
Zrobiono
Topologia — Home Gateway, Switch, Server-PT (SMTP), SBC-PT, Laptop i Smartphone.
Dodano wszystkie urządzenia IoT (czujniki, wentylator, lampę, okno, drzwi + RFID).
Skonfigurowano Wi-Fi (SSID HomeGateway), DHCP, serwer pocztowy i dwa konta e-mail.
Skrypt Python na SBC-PT: reakcja na temperaturę, wilgotność, poziom wody, dym; nocne oświetlenie; otwieranie drzwi kartą; powiadomienia e-mail.
Nie działa
Drzwi (IoT4) i czytnik RFID (IoT13) nie przyjmują poleceń ze skryptu → nie otwierają się/nie zamykają.
Powiadomienia e-mail nie są wysyłane, a pełne testy nie przechodzą.
Załączniki 1